The IMF expects global economic growth to fall from 5.9 per cent in 2021 to 4.4 per cent in 2022.

The spread of the Omicron variant has meant the global economy has entered 2022 in a weaker position than previously expected, while facing multiple challenges, the International Monetary Fund has warned.
